MSSQL实例查询:从入门到精通

什么是MSSQL实例?

MSSQL实例是指安装在计算机上的MSSQL Server的一个实例。一个计算机可以同时安装多个MSSQL实例,每个实例都有自己独立的数据库、安全性、配置等属性,实例之间相互独立。

MSSQL实例的查询方法

1. 使用SQL Server Management Studio查询

SQL Server Management Studio是MSSQL Server的一款官方集成开发环境工具,可以通过该工具查询MSSQL实例。下面是具体操作:

1) 打开SQL Server Management Studio工具

代码内容

2) 在连接窗口中填写服务器名称和登录验证模式,并连接到MSSQL Server

代码内容

3) 在“对象资源管理器”中展开树形结构,找到想要查询的实例名,右键点击并选择“新建查询”

代码内容

4) 在新打开的查询窗口中输入SQL语句进行查询

代码内容

2. 使用命令行查询

通过命令行也可以查询MSSQL实例,下面是具体操作:

1) 打开命令行窗口

代码内容

2) 输入以下命令,连接到MSSQL Server

sqlcmd -S 服务器名称 -U 用户名 -P 密码

3) 连接成功后,可以输入SQL语句进行查询

代码内容

MSSQL实例的常用查询操作

1. 查询所有实例名称

使用以下SQL语句可以查询当前服务器上所有的MSSQL实例名称:

EXECUTE master.dbo.xp_instance_regread N'HKEY_LOCAL_MACHINE', N'SOFTWARE\Microsoft\Microsoft SQL Server', N'InstalledInstances'

2. 查询实例中所有数据库名称

使用以下SQL语句可以查询指定MSSQL实例中所有的数据库名称:

SELECT name FROM master..sysdatabases

3. 查询实例中指定数据库中所有表名称

使用以下SQL语句可以查询指定MSSQL实例中指定数据库中所有的表名称:

USE 数据库名称; SELECT name FROM sys.objects WHERE type = 'U'

总结

MSSQL实例是MSSQL Server的一种实例化方式,通过SQL Server Management Studio和命令行均可连接并查询。常用的查询操作包括查询实例名称、查询数据库名称和查询表名称等。

数据库标签